What Can the Brand DNA Agent Do?

The complete guide to Brand DNA's agent: the questions it answers, the data it reads, the actions it takes on your calendar, articles, and site, and the things it deliberately leaves to you.

The agent is a chat interface over a large toolbox: live SEO data, your own Google accounts, your content calendar, and KoalaWriter. This page lists the data it reads, what it can change, and what it deliberately leaves to you.

The data it reads

Most of this works with zero setup on any domain. Connecting Search Console and Analytics adds your own numbers on top, so estimates give way to what actually happened.

  • Google Search Console: your real queries, clicks, CTR, and positions, plus indexing status for specific URLs.
  • Google Analytics: sessions, traffic sources, and engagement, with period-over-period comparison.
  • Keyword data: related ideas, long-tail variations, exact monthly volumes, competition, and difficulty, in your market and language.
  • Google Trends: interest over time for up to five terms at once, the direction it is moving, and the rising queries around a topic.
  • Rankings and competitors: what any domain ranks for, who overlaps with you, the pages earning their traffic, and the keywords they hold that you do not.
  • Backlinks: your profile, referring domains by authority, anchor text spread, and the domains linking to a competitor but not to you.
  • Live Google results: searched from a specific city when intent is local, including the map pack, People Also Ask, and AI Overviews with the sources they cite.
  • Pinterest Trends for visual niches, and Amazon product data for affiliate content.
  • Your site itself: your sitemap, any page's text or HTML, and a robots.txt check for whether AI crawlers are blocked.

What it can change

  • KoalaWriter: queue an article, apply a preset, edit a finished one.
  • Content Calendar: plan, schedule, reschedule, and remove tasks.
  • Brand DNA itself: knowledge base, memory, goals, and writer defaults.
  • KoalaLinks schema: site-wide rules and per-URL JSON-LD, drafted disabled for you to review.

What it leaves to you

  • Writer settings stay yours: the AI model, image model and quality, formatting flags, internal-linking domain, and prompt overrides live in Brand DNA under Settings → Writing
  • Long-form drafting happens in KoalaWriter so every article gets the full research pipeline; the agent won't paste an article into chat
  • Calendar tasks are always new articles; optimization and outreach come back as recommendations for you to act on
  • Schema changes and indexing requests happen only when you explicitly ask
  • Anything that spends credits or touches your live site gets confirmed with you first
